Transaction 8d8e66ae78fb3a25b6da554ac7402d051642f419a1f14001a932b82afb656b0e

block
3ecd26d2bf52ec80fe55e66ece8edd33e4d0ce09479c84cd216b87452baf7a85

1 Input

23 Outputs